What are common installation mistakes to avoid?
Common installation mistakes to avoid include improper base preparation, neglecting drainage, and failing to align pavers correctly. Ensuring a solid foundation and proper leveling is crucial for a durable and visually appealing result.

How can I ensure proper drainage with pavers?
Ensuring proper drainage with pavers involves installing them with a slight slope away from structures, using a permeable base, and leaving gaps between pavers for water to flow through. This helps prevent pooling and promotes effective drainage.

How do I prepare my yard for paver installation?
Preparing your yard for paver installation involves clearing the area of debris, grass, and plants, ensuring proper drainage, and leveling the ground. Additionally, mark the layout for the pavers to guide the installation process effectively.
